The Facts:
Falls and resultant fractures in people aged 65 and over account for over 4 million bed days each year in England.

Injurious falls, including over 60,000 hip fractures annually, are the leading cause of accident-related mortality in older people.

The National Patient Safety Agency estimates that the average direct cost of patient falls to an 800 bed acute hospital would be £92,000 per year.
